Position:home  

Unleashing the Power of the EP2C8F256I8N: A Comprehensive Guide for FPGA Developers

Introduction

In the ever-evolving field of FPGA (Field-Programmable Gate Array) development, the EP2C8F256I8N stands out as a highly versatile and powerful solution. This advanced FPGA offers an exceptional combination of performance, flexibility, and cost-effectiveness, making it an ideal choice for a wide range of applications.

Key Features and Benefits of the EP2C8F256I8N

The EP2C8F256I8N boasts an impressive array of features that empower FPGA developers to create innovative and demanding designs. These include:

EP2C8F256I8N

EP2C8F256I8N

  • High Logic Capacity: With 256,000 logic elements, the EP2C8F256I8N provides ample resources to implement complex designs.
  • Embedded Memory Blocks: The FPGA incorporates 256,000 bits of dual-port embedded RAM, enabling efficient data storage and processing.
  • High-Speed Interfaces: The EP2C8F256I8N supports multiple high-speed interfaces, including PCI Express Gen 1 and USB 2.0, ensuring seamless connectivity to external devices.
  • Low Power Consumption: Optimized for power efficiency, the EP2C8F256I8N consumes significantly less power compared to other FPGAs in its class.
  • Advanced Security Features: The FPGA features advanced security mechanisms, such as encryption and key management, to protect sensitive data and intellectual property.

Benefits for Developers:

The EP2C8F256I8N offers numerous benefits for FPGA developers, including:

Unleashing the Power of the EP2C8F256I8N: A Comprehensive Guide for FPGA Developers

Unleashing the Power of the EP2C8F256I8N: A Comprehensive Guide for FPGA Developers

Key Features and Benefits of the EP2C8F256I8N

  • Reduced Design Complexity: The FPGA's extensive logic resources and embedded memory blocks enable developers to implement complex designs with fewer components, simplifying development.
  • Accelerated Time-to-Market: The FPGA's high performance and pre-verified IP cores allow developers to quickly prototype and implement designs, speeding up product development.
  • Lower Development Costs: The EP2C8F256I8N's cost-effectiveness reduces the total cost of FPGA development, making it an economical solution for small and large projects alike.

Applications of the EP2C8F256I8N

The EP2C8F256I8N finds applications in diverse industries, including:

  • Automotive: Advanced driver-assistance systems, vehicle control modules
  • Industrial Automation: Motion control, process monitoring, robotics
  • Communications: Network infrastructure, wireless base stations
  • Consumer Electronics: Smart home appliances, gaming consoles, digital cameras
  • Medical Devices: Diagnostic equipment, patient monitoring systems

Industry Recognition and Market Impact

The EP2C8F256I8N has garnered significant recognition from the industry for its superior performance and versatility. Market research firm Gartner estimates that the FPGA market will experience steady growth in the coming years, driven in part by the increasing demand for high-performance computing and embedded systems.

Key Features and Benefits of the EP2C8F256I8N

Technical Specifications and Comparison

Technical Specifications

Parameter Value
Logic Capacity 256,000 LUTs
Embedded RAM 256,000 bits
Interfaces PCI Express Gen 1, USB 2.0, Gigabit Ethernet
Power Consumption 500 mW (typical)
Package 100-ball FBGA

Comparison with Competing FPGAs

Parameter EP2C8F256I8N Comparable FPGA A Comparable FPGA B
Logic Capacity 256,000 LUTs 200,000 LUTs 150,000 LUTs
Embedded RAM 256,000 bits 128,000 bits 64,000 bits
Interfaces PCI Express Gen 1, USB 2.0, Gigabit Ethernet PCI Express Gen 2 USB 1.1
Power Consumption 500 mW (typical) 700 mW (typical) 900 mW (typical)
Cost Lower Moderate Higher

Step-by-Step Approach to FPGA Development with the EP2C8F256I8N

  1. Design Creation: Use a high-level design language, such as VHDL or Verilog, to define the FPGA's functionality.
  2. Simulation and Verification: Simulate and verify the design using simulation tools to identify and correct errors.
  3. Synthesis: Translate the high-level design into a low-level implementation that the FPGA can understand.
  4. Placement and Routing: Determine the physical location of the logic elements and routing connections on the FPGA.
  5. Programming: Load the FPGA with the generated bitstream to configure its functionality.
  6. Testing and Debugging: Thoroughly test the implemented design to ensure it meets the specified requirements.

Why Matters and Benefits

Why the EP2C8F256I8N Matters:

The EP2C8F256I8N is a significant FPGA development because it provides a compelling combination of performance, flexibility, and affordability. It empowers developers to create innovative designs that address the challenges of modern embedded systems.

Benefits of Using the EP2C8F256I8N:

  • Improved System Performance: The FPGA's high logic capacity and fast processing capabilities enable the implementation of complex algorithms and real-time applications.
  • Enhanced Flexibility: The FPGA's versatile architecture supports a wide range of interfaces and I/O standards, providing adaptability to different system requirements.
  • Reduced Development Costs: The FPGA's cost-effectiveness and pre-verified IP cores significantly reduce the overall cost of FPGA development.

Stories and Lessons Learned

Story 1:

Developing an Automotive Safety System

Unleashing the Power of the EP2C8F256I8N: A Comprehensive Guide for FPGA Developers

A leading automotive manufacturer utilized the EP2C8F256I8N in a safety system for a new vehicle model. The FPGA's high-speed interfaces enabled real-time data processing from multiple sensors, allowing for rapid and accurate decision-making in critical situations.

Lessons Learned:

Unleashing the Power of the EP2C8F256I8N: A Comprehensive Guide for FPGA Developers

  • The FPGA's high logic capacity facilitated the implementation of complex safety algorithms.
  • The pre-verified IP cores reduced development time and simplified system integration.

Story 2:

Creating a Smart Home Gateway

A technology company developed a smart home gateway powered by the EP2C8F256I8N. The FPGA provided the flexibility to connect to various smart home devices and enabled the implementation of intelligent automation routines.

Lessons Learned:

  • The FPGA's embedded memory supported efficient data storage and retrieval.
  • The advanced security features protected sensitive user information and communication.

Story 3:

Designing an Industrial Robot Controller

An industrial automation company used the EP2C8F256I8N in the controller of a robotic arm. The FPGA's ability to handle high-speed motion control algorithms enabled precise and reliable robot movement.

Lessons Learned:

  • The FPGA's low power consumption optimized the energy efficiency of the robotic system.
  • The FPGA's advanced I/O capabilities facilitated interface with various sensors and actuators.

FAQs

  1. What is the pin count of the EP2C8F256I8N?
    - The EP2C8F256I8N has a 100-ball FBGA package.

  2. Does the EP2C8F256I8N support DDR memory?
    - No, the EP2C8F256I8N does not support DDR memory.

  3. What are the recommended development tools for the EP2C8F256I8N?
    - Altera's Quartus Prime software suite is the recommended development environment for the EP2C8F256I8N.

  4. Is the EP2C8F256I8N compatible with ARM processors?
    - Yes, the EP2C8F256I8N can be interfaced with ARM processors using the Altera SOPC Builder tool.

  5. What is the expected lifespan of the EP2C8F256I8N?
    - The EP2C8F256I8N has an estimated lifespan of 15 years, providing long-term reliability in industrial and automotive applications.

  6. Is the EP2C8F256I8N suitable for high-temperature environments?
    - Yes, the EP2C8F256I8N can operate in temperatures ranging from -40°C to 100°C, making it suitable for industrial and automotive environments.

  7. Does the EP2C8F256I8N offer radiation tolerance?
    - No, the EP2C8F256I8N is not radiation tolerant and should not be used in applications with high radiation levels.

  8. What is the cost of the EP2C8F256I8N?
    - The cost of the EP2C8F256I8N

Time:2024-10-17 22:25:29 UTC

electronic   

TOP 10
Related Posts
Don't miss